Living in CyprusNestled into the eastern Mediterranean Sea and at the crossroads of three continents, Cyprus is the third largest island in the Mediterranean. It is an ideal starting point to discover exotic locations such as the Greek Islands, Egypt and the Middle East, mini-cruises are available for these locations almost every day from Cyprus. The rich story of the island can be traced back over 10,000 years. Like many Mediterranean islands, Cyprus has long been seen as an important strategic base with various civilisations having swept through over the years from the Ottoman Turks to the British, the Greeks to the Romans. Throughout Cyprus, the landscape is typically Mediterranean and is blessed with the timeless beauty of antiquities. Tall cypress trees frame crusader fortresses, Greco-Roman theatres are carved out of cliffs and Byzantine monasteries are seen perched on mountaintops with sophisticated cities successfully balancing the ancient and modern. Despite its political problems, Cyprus is a modern country that effortlessly marries European culture with indelible links to the past. Visitors can discover a compact world of clean beaches and rugged mountain peaks, vineyards studded with olive trees and ancient ruins that stir the imagination, citrus groves and old stone villages where 21st-century Europe seems a very long way away indeed. Cyprus provides a high level of European living standards, with the average living cost reaching only up to 70% of most European countries. The overall cost of living averages about 1/3 to 2/3 of most parts of Europe, Japan or the USA. This is an added appeal for Europeans, because it gives the opportunity of high level and yet inexpensive lifestyle. The local markets flaunt a wealth of colourful fresh fruit and vegetables, meat and fish, and Cyprus' modern supermarkets are fully stocked with a large range of local and imported goods. Non Cypriot residents are entitled for duty free privileges, including cars and domestic appliances |
